>85,000$
>only one trim


what the actual fuck was Toyota thinking?
>>
It's because of Toyotas manufacturing ethos, they try to perfect the process as much as possible, so having 20 different configs on a low production car isn't going to happen, for the same reason they don't constantly update and refresh models/chassis. They will never have the newest tech and flashiest doodads on the Land Cruiser. They are great though, they just don't really have a market anymore, not many people care about a dead reliable, rock solid SUV with 10 year old tech. The LC and G Wagon have their devotees but don't really draw in new buyers.
